HPE ITOC universe

The HPE ITOC Universe defines classes that contain typical HPE ITOC objects related to compliance and inventory. When you run either a standard or a custom compliance report, you will use these objects. The resulting reports provide information about the compliance levels of your HPE ITOC devices.

Universe elements

Universes contain three basic elements: objects, classes, and query filters.

Object

An object represents a specific set of data in your HPE ITOC database. Each object is given a term that has specific meaning in HPE ITOC. The types of objects are as follows:

  • Dimension - A dimension object () retrieves the data that provides the basis for analysis in a report. Dimension objects typically retrieve character type data. For example, on an HPE ITOC machine, the business service contains dimensions such as Business Service Name, Business Service ID, and Business Service Priority.
    • An associated dimension object () is related to the dimension above it.
  • Measure - A measure object () performs a numerical evaluation on the data in the database report. An example of a measure object is Number of Policies.
  • Class - A class is a logical grouping of related objects. Web Intelligence represents a class with a folder () icon. Each class can contain one or more subclasses. Subclasses contain objects that are further categorized into subcategories.

    When you create queries on a universe, classes help you to find the objects that represent the information that you want to find.

  • Query Filter - A query filter object allows you to restrict the data returned by an object in a query. Query filters are represented by a yellow funnel () icon. Two examples of query filters are Till Date and As Of Date. These query filters enable you to select the time frame for the report.
    Note: Date filters carry a timestamp of 00:00:00. A report with a date filter of "Today" will not include items that were inserted in the database after midnight. To capture items inserted in the database after midnight, set the date filter to tomorrow's date.

Log in to the HPE ITOC universe

Perform the following steps to log in to the HPE ITOC Universe.

  1. Log in to the BI Launch Pad:

    https://<SAP-BO-IP-ADDRESS:port>/BOE/BI

    The BI Launch Pad login page opens:

  2. Enter the SAP BO user name and password.
  3. Click Log On.
  4. From the Applications drop-down, select Web Intelligence. The SAP BusinessObjects Web Intelligence window opens.
  5. In the Web Intelligence bar, click the New ( ) icon and select Universe. The Create a Document window opens.
  6. Select Universe, and click OK.
  7. The Universe window opens. Select the universe.
